Go to Etsy and search for "rental property tracker," and you will find hundreds of nice spreadsheets to track 10-20 rentals, usually for under $10.Software has extremely helpful features like online payments, marketing syndication (click a button, and your property is advertised on multiple sites), electronic document review/signing, maintenance tracking, and owner reports.

The majority of buyers appreciate the expertise that a good agent provides (local market knowledge that can only be gained by being active in the market buying and selling all the time, looking at most of the new listings in person or at least online daily, a background in or at least understanding of building construction, relationships within the network of professionals in the industry doing deals, vendor referrals, legal protection through E&O insurance and keeping up with constant changes in approved contracts and required disclosures and forms, negotiating skills (the average person is terrible at negotiating directly and has no desire to, I find Americans are uniquely averse to negotiating and prefer to outsource it but I digress), etc.).
